Binary package hint: gvfs

This is on a new system with old hardware. amd X2 64 4200+>Nvidia
6150Se> 1Gig of ram. After a clean install and applying all updates when
i delete a file to the trash, sometimes it shows up in the trash, and
sometimes it does not. Trash icon is saying no trash and there is trash
inside, also icon shows trash inside after i have deleted  trash. Then
when i go into trying to remove the trash i have to click two times on
empty trash before it emptys. Also after doing this a couple times the
empty trash tab becomes grey, then i can not empty trash. This happens
on 32-bit ubuntu 8.04Lts and 64bit. Not sure if its a hardware issue.
After rebooting it lets me empty trash a couple times then just
replicates the same behaviour as before. Driving me Nuts. Thanks I miss
my Ubuntu.
